I am popping in very quickly to share a sympathy card I've made for a dear friend who lost her husband to cancer last week and I will get it in the mail tomorrow.


I used the current Atlantic Hearts sketch, first opening it in PSE, resizing to 5x7 and then printing out.

Here's are a few close-ups to try to show all the gold sparkly shimmer on this card. Click to enlarge. I sprayed Smooch Spritz in Gold and Pink on a white card through a Stamplorations butterfly stencil and trimmed it down for my first layer on my SU card stock card base.

I rounded the corners of my card base with my Cropadile Corner Chomper. I used some snippets of black-gold Shimmering card stock that were in my stash to die cut a QK Photo Corner and a Spellbinders Basics rectangle to mat behind the focal butterflies. In between, I used a piece of patterned flowery gold foil card stock from SEI's Sunny Day collection.

I used the rest of the SEI paper on the card back, along with some snippets from the front leftovers and an Impression Obsession siggie stamped in VersaMark and heat-embossed with white embossing powder.

I stamped my Pink By Design sentiment on another black-gold snippet with VersaMark and heat-embossed with white embossing powder. The 2 butterflies are Papertrey Ink's Butterfly Kisses stamps and coordinating die. After die cutting them, I stamped with VersaMark and then heat-embossed with detailed gold embossing powder. I adhered them to the paper on their centers with a 1/3-inch glue dot so their wings remained free. I finished off the card with a few sparkly gold enamel dots and tiny punched butterflies using the last of my black-gold snippet.

After posting the card last night, I found this patterned paper in my 12X12 Colorbok Deliliah collection and added it to the inside of the card, along with sentiments stamped in Memento Tuxedo black ink and made by Pink By Design. This leaves room for a handwritten note on the left and signing the card on the right. Note to File: great way to use those larger sized papers with an image in the corner.
